The Demon King's Last Stand: The Forbidden Temple of Shadows
In the heart of the desolate wasteland, where the sun rarely pierced the thick, ominous clouds, lay the ancient and forbidden temple of shadows. It was said that those who dared to enter would never return, their souls forever trapped within the temple's dark embrace. Yet, in a world where cultivation and demons intertwined, the Demon King, once feared and now seeking redemption, felt an inexplicable pull towards this cursed place.
The Demon King, known as Xuan, had once been the most powerful and feared cultivator in the land. His name was synonymous with terror, and his reign of terror had left a scar on the hearts of many. But as the years passed, Xuan's heart grew weary of the endless cycle of violence and destruction. He sought a way to break free from the chains of his past and to atone for his sins.
It was during one of his solitary meditations that Xuan had a vision. In the depths of his mind, he saw the temple of shadows, its gates shimmering with an otherworldly light. The vision was clear and vivid, and it left him with a sense of urgency. He knew that this temple held the key to his redemption, but it also held a dark secret that could shatter the fragile peace that had settled over the land.
Xuan gathered his closest allies, a group of former enemies who had found common ground in their shared desire for peace. Among them was Ling, a former demon hunter who had once sought to destroy Xuan but had been unable to overcome her own humanity. There was also Feng, a wise and ancient cultivator who had seen more than his fair share of the world's darkness, and Mei, a young and ambitious cultivator whose heart was as fierce as her spirit.
As they journeyed towards the temple, the group encountered numerous challenges. The wasteland was filled with the remnants of old battles, and the air was thick with the scent of decay. They fought off bands of rogue cultivators and encountered creatures that were once the stuff of legend. Each encounter tested their resolve and their unity, but they pressed on, driven by Xuan's vision and the promise of redemption.
Upon reaching the temple, they were greeted by a gatekeeper, an ancient spirit bound to the temple's very existence. The spirit spoke in riddles and cryptic warnings, but Xuan, with his keen intellect and unwavering determination, deciphered its words. The temple, it seemed, was a place of balance, where the forces of good and evil were constantly at war. To gain entry, Xuan must face the trials that would test his worthiness.
The first trial was a mirror, reflecting not only Xuan's physical form but also his soul. He saw the demons he had once been, the terror he had wrought upon the world. He saw the pain and suffering he had caused, and for a moment, he was overcome by guilt and regret. But then, he saw the man he had become, a man who had repented and sought to make amends. With a deep breath, he stepped forward, accepting his past and vowing to change his future.
The second trial was a labyrinth, filled with illusions and deceit. Xuan and his allies navigated the maze, each step fraught with danger. They encountered their own fears and doubts, and they had to confront the shadows of their pasts. Ling, for instance, had to face the demon she had once been, the hunter who had sought to destroy Xuan. Feng had to grapple with the darkness within him, the darkness that had driven him to seek power. Mei, young and ambitious, had to confront her desire for control and the consequences of her actions.
The trials continued, each more difficult than the last. Xuan and his allies fought together, their bonds growing stronger with each challenge. They faced off against the spirits of the temple, beings of immense power and ancient knowledge. They learned about the balance between good and evil, and they understood that the true battle was not just against external foes but against the darkness within themselves.
The final trial was the most daunting of all. Xuan was confronted by his own shadow, a manifestation of his darkest fears and regrets. It was a battle of wills, a battle that would determine his fate and the fate of the world. The shadow tried to consume him, to drag him back into the darkness from which he had emerged. But Xuan, with the help of his friends, fought back with all his might.
In the end, it was not just Xuan's physical form that was tested but his heart and soul. He had to choose between the darkness that had once defined him and the light that he now sought to embrace. With a final, desperate effort, Xuan banished his shadow, and the temple's gates opened, revealing a path to redemption.
As they stepped through the gates, Xuan and his allies were greeted by a vision of a world at peace, a world where cultivation and demons coexisted in harmony. The temple had been a place of balance, and Xuan's journey had restored that balance. He had faced his past and his inner demons, and he had emerged stronger and more compassionate.
The Demon King's Last Stand: The Forbidden Temple of Shadows was not just a tale of redemption but a testament to the power of friendship and the strength of the human spirit. It was a story that would be told for generations, a story that would inspire hope and courage in the face of darkness.
